So, when is the right time to upgrade your home security system? Here are the best times to consider making a change:
1. After a Break-In or Security Threat
If you've experienced a burglary, attempted break-in, or even suspicious activity near your home, it’s a clear sign your current security setup may not be enough. Upgrading your system with newer cameras, alarms, or motion sensors can help you prevent future incidents.
2. When Moving Into a New Home
A new home means a new neighborhood, new vulnerabilities, and new layout challenges. Upgrading or installing a custom security system ensures that your family and belongings are protected right from the start.
3. When Your System is Outdated
If your system is more than 5-7 years old, it’s likely missing key modern features — like smartphone integration, HD video, cloud storage, or smart home compatibility. An upgrade gives you access to the latest tech for better peace of mind.
4. After a Life Change
Major life events — like having a baby, starting a home business, or an elderly family member moving in — may require improved safety and monitoring. A security system upgrade can be tailored to these new needs.
5. Seasonal Transitions
Changes in daylight, holiday travel, or even summer vacations are all great reminders to reevaluate your home’s security. For example, more break-ins occur during summer when people are away. A quick upgrade before the season changes can make a big difference.
6. When You're Upgrading Other Tech
Already upgrading your smart home devices? It's the perfect time to make sure your security system integrates well. Smart locks, video doorbells, and voice-controlled assistants work best when part of a seamless system.
